Key Takeaways GHRP-6 and GHRP-2 are synthetic hexapeptides that mimic ghrelin and trigger natural growth hormone release through the GHSR-1a receptor GHRP-6 (development name SKF-110679) is the older compound and produces strong appetite stimulation, useful for bulking but unwelcome for fat loss GHRP-2 (also called Pralmorelin) produces a slightly stronger GH pulse with much less appetite stimulation, making it a cleaner option for body recomposition Both raise cortisol and prolactin moderately, which is the main drawback compared to newer peptides like ipamorelin Standard dosing: 100 to 300 mcg subcutaneously, 1 to 3 times daily, on an empty stomach Both peptides synergize with GHRH analogs (CJC-1295, sermorelin) and are commonly stacked with them Newer alternatives (ipamorelin, MK-677) offer cleaner side effect profiles and have largely replaced GHRP-6/GHRP-2 in modern protocols This GHRP-6 vs GHRP-2 guide covers what each peptide is, how they work, the benefits and side effects you should actually expect, the dosing math, and how the two stack up against each other and against the modern alternatives that came after them
